Solution Overview
Problem
Current methods for preventing credit card fraud, such as signature matching and photo identification, are inadequate and often impractical, leading to significant financial losses for credit card issuing companies and merchants due to the inability to effectively secure transactions before unauthorized use.
Innovation Solution
A system and method for pre-configuring payment vehicles, such as credit cards, by specifying transaction criteria like merchant location, type, date, and amount, which are communicated to a pre-configuration and authorization engine to ensure only authorized transactions are approved, using smart devices and various communication methods to notify users and pre-populate transaction details.

Methods and systems for pre-configuring a payment vehicle are described. In some embodiments, transaction criteria pertaining to a payment vehicle is proactively received in advance of an anticipated transaction. A transaction authorization request may be received from a point of sale device and may be generated by the point of sale device in response to an attempted use of the payment vehicle. Information about the transaction in the transaction request may be compared with the transaction criteria to determine whether to authorize the transaction.
